What Is an Unsecured Business Loan?
An unsecured loan allows your business to borrow money without offering property, vehicles, or equipment as collateral. That makes it quicker to arrange, but riskier for lender – so approvals depend heavily on your creditworthiness and trading history.
These loans are popular for:
Supporting cash flow
Funding short-term growth
Bridging gaps in project or invoice payments
Launching new services or branches
How to Boost Your Approval Odds
Here are the most effective ways to improve your chances of securing an unsecured business loan:
1. Know Your Credit Score
Lenders will look at both business and sometimes personal credit scores (especially for sole traders or small businesses).
Get your business credit report from providers like Experian or Creditsafe.
Fix any errors or outdated information.
Avoid applying for multiple loans at once, as this can negatively affect your score.
2. Keep Financial Records Up to Date
Clear, accurate records help lenders see that your business is stable and well-managed.
Provide up to date accounts (ideally from an accountant)
Show regular income and a healthy cash flow
Be prepared to share bank statements (usually 3-6 months)
Did You Know?
Lenders may also look at your industry and average turnover trends – so even if your numbers look good, context matters.
3. Demonstrate Affordability
Lenders want confidence that you can repay the loan – without it putting stress on your business.
Be realistic about the amount you’re borrowing
Choose a repayment term that suits your cash flow
Avoid overstretching to get a larger loan than needed
4. Explain the Purpose of the Loan
Providing a short explanation or plan for how the money will be used makes you appear more credible and prepared.
For example:
“To buy new machinery to increase production by 30%”
“To cover staff costs during a seasonal dip in revenue”
This also helps lenders judge how essential the loan is to your operations.

Quick Checklist Before You Apply
Business accounts (preferably 1–2 years’ trading history)
Up-to-date bank statements
A solid explanation of why you need the funds
Good credit rating (or steps taken to improve it)
Realistic repayment plan
Who Can Get an Unsecured Business Loan?
Unsecured loans are ideal for:
Service-based businesses without physical assets
Companies needing fast access to cash
Directors who want to avoid risking personal or company assets
Even if your credit history isn’t perfect, there are lenders who take a more flexible view – especially when using a broker who knows the market.
